Technological Disruption & Innovation in South Korea Communication Base Station Equipment Flex PCB Market

Disruptive innovations are reshaping the South Korean flex PCB industry, driven by breakthroughs in high-frequency materials, miniaturization techniques, and flexible substrate engineering. The adoption of novel materials such as liquid crystal polymers (LCP) and advanced ceramics enhances signal integrity and thermal management, critical for 5G applications.

AI-powered design automation tools are enabling manufacturers to optimize flex PCB layouts for high-density interconnects, reducing prototyping cycles and costs. Additive manufacturing techniques are also emerging, allowing for rapid customization and complex geometries that traditional subtractive processes cannot achieve.

Furthermore, integration of embedded components within flex substrates is a game-changing trend, reducing assembly complexity and improving reliability. These technological disruptions are expected to accelerate the deployment of ultra-compact, high-performance base stations, solidifying South Korea’s leadership in 5G infrastructure innovation.
